Attachments: | First beta for the 2.075.0 release. This release comes with various phobos additions, a repackaged std.datetime, configurable Fiber stack guard pages (now also on Posix), and optional precise scanning for the DATA/TLS segment (static data) on Windows. http://dlang.org/download.html#dmd_beta http://dlang.org/changelog/2.075.0.html Please report any bugs at https://issues.dlang.org - -Martin |

Posted in reply to Dsby | On 6/28/2017 7:09 PM, Dsby wrote:
> On Thursday, 29 June 2017 at 01:44:10 UTC, Walter Bright wrote:
>> On 6/27/2017 12:51 AM, Dsby wrote:
>>> what about DIP1000? Is it default?
>>
>> No.
>
> When will it be default? 2.076 or 2.077?
I don't know at the moment. Currently, Phobos doesn't compile with it on because Phobos has some safety violations in it that need correction.
I expect a lot of existing code will have similar issues, and so we'll need a long period before making it the default.
